E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
WKWebView
WKWebView
和UIWebView查看访问网页html内容的方法
WKWebView
:NSString*doc=@"document.body.outerHTML";[self.myWebViewevaluateJavaScript:doccompletionHandler
抬头看见柠檬树
·
2020-08-20 09:12
iOS学习记录
WKWebView
加载网页加载不出来问题
之前有一个项目一直使用
WKWebView
,比UIWebView占用性能少很多,而且很流畅。网上有很多小伙伴遇到一个问题,
WKWebView
加载网页加载不出来,白屏等,于是就说WK还不成熟。
Morris_
·
2020-08-20 09:38
#
error
&
warning
基于 LocalWebServer 实现
WKWebView
离线资源加载
背景笔者在《
WKWebView
》一文中提到过,
WKWebView
在独立于app进程之外的进程中执行网络请求,请求数据不经过主进程,因此,在
WKWebView
上直接使用NSURLProtocol无法拦截请求
CoderSmallfan
·
2020-08-20 08:25
iOS-浏览器
WKWebView
和UIWebView加载本地html和JS交互各种坑解决办法
因为苹果的文件机制,所有的资源文件都相当于放在bundle的路径里,里面不分任何文件夹路径,所以我们在加载(js,css,png)等等的资源文件的时候,不应该加上任何文件名,所以最好是把所有有关html的文件都放在同一平级的文件夹UIWebView1.OC调JS/***ocCalls:js的函数名*/JSValue*value=self.jsContext[@"ocCalls"];/***@[@"
老王SK
·
2020-08-20 08:12
OC小技巧
WKWebView
使用,代替UIWebView
所以,我们良心的苹果公司在iOS8之后推出了
WKWebView
来代替UIWebView!使用了
WKWebView
智斗,内存不爆表了,加载速度快了,一口气上五楼也不累了!!!
杰铭的博客
·
2020-08-20 08:53
iOS
WKWebview
实战
一、配置1、初始化导入头文件#import#pragmamark-LazyLoad-(
WKWebView
*)webView{if(!
init_yue
·
2020-08-20 07:05
iOS解决APP进入后台WebView上音频继续播放问题
公司最近有一需求,在对应的web文章上添加音频播放,音频为audio标签.有两种解决方案第一种.我们可以在
WKWebView
销毁的时候或者app进入后台的时候添加[webviewloadRequest:
JessWang
·
2020-08-20 06:18
39-
WKWebView
项目实践分享(四) - 先了解下Cookie
系列文章:《37-
WKWebView
项目实践分享(一)-UIWebView回顾介绍》《43-
WKWebView
项目实践分享(二)-
WKWebView
介绍》《38-
WKWebView
项目实践分享(三)-native
春田花花幼儿园
·
2020-08-20 04:16
WKWebView
与 JS 交互实战技巧
Xcode8发布之后Apple推出了新控件
WKWebView
,
WKWebView
存在很多优势支持更多的HTML5的特性、高达60fps滚动刷新频率与内置手势、与Safari相容的JavaScript引擎
海笙樾
·
2020-08-19 23:54
iOS 手机常见功能总结(一)
文章目录一:打电话1、旧的API:openURL2、新的API:openURL:urloptions:completionHandler:附:3、利用WebView吊起电话3.1UIWebView3.2
WKWebView
鹤九霄
·
2020-08-19 23:48
iOS-OC
Swift-
WKWebView
与JS交互处理H5页面问题
因为
WKWebView
的性能明显优于UIWebV
生无可恋的程序员
·
2020-08-19 19:20
WKWebView
(一)
WKWebView
头文件声明//webview配置@property(n
healthbird
·
2020-08-19 17:21
WKWebView
的使用
iOS8更新的
WKWebView
,说说项目中怎么用它,其中包括了获取标题,加载进度,和webview跟原生的交互打电话。
charlotte2018
·
2020-08-19 08:33
iOS-UIWebView、
WKWebView
、JS、热更新相关
小摩丝.jpg本篇涵盖JS、UIWebView、
WKWebView
,热更新交互热更新相关等.1.iOSJavaScriptCore实现OC与JS的交互2.WebView添加头视图并下拉放大3.JSPatch
守护地中海的花
·
2020-08-19 08:20
WKWebView
使用KVO监听contentSize的异常闪退
因为使用下面的方法会出现内容先加载出来,高度有延迟调整的情况,不符合要求-(void)webView:(
WKWebView
*)webViewdidFinishNavigation:(WKNavigation
猜火车丶
·
2020-08-19 07:21
WKWebView
WKWebViewAPI介绍
WKWebView
的头文件声明//webview配置,具体看下面@property(nonatomic,readonly,copy)WKWebViewConfiguration
小小小小攻城狮
·
2020-08-19 03:38
WKWebView
与UIWebView的区别
WKWebView
与UIWebView的区别iOS8以后,苹果推出了新框架Wekkit,提供了替换UIWebView的组件
WKWebView
。使用
WKWebView
,速度会更快,占用内存少。
Adam_潜
·
2020-08-19 01:41
ios swift
WKWebView
(一)基本了解
苹果官方文档对
WKWebView
的解读,在iOS8和OSX10.10开始,使用
WKWebView
向应用程序添加Web内容。不要使用UIWebView或WebView。
flyToSky_L
·
2020-08-18 20:33
ios笔记
swift
WKWebView
图片文字大小的自适应
#第一种:初始化的时候赋值(界面自适应大小包括图片和文字)WKWebViewConfiguration*configuration=[[WKWebViewConfigurationalloc]init];WKPreferences*preferences=[[WKPreferencesalloc]init];preferences.javaScriptCanOpenWindowsAutomatic
Wulitc
·
2020-08-18 14:43
OC
IOS WebView控件详解
概述WebView就是一个内嵌浏览器控件,在iOS中主要有两种WebView:UIWebView和
WKWebView
,UIWebView是iOS2之后开始使用,
WKWebView
是在iOS8开始使用,
WKWebView
xiangzhihong8
·
2020-08-18 06:08
ios
ios开发大揭秘
iOS UITextView 富文本显示html标签
一般来说iOS端显示html标签用的都是UIWebView或
WKWebView
,做的比较方便快捷,但是加载速度也是比较慢的,所以这里记录并推荐一种比较简单的方式:///显示富文本+(NSAttributedString
Hellowongwong
·
2020-08-18 04:59
UILabel加载html文本
本人感觉UILabel加载html文本并不好,现在有
WKWebView
是比较好用的。即使不用
WKWebView
也可以返回JSON数据,在客户端这边进行布局。之所以利用UILabel加载ht
梁森森
·
2020-08-18 03:18
iOS开发
Xcode工程加载H5本地文件 H5里面引入js/css文件
在本地的H5项目里面,还有js/css文件,使用
WKWebview
怎么样把H5界面加载出来?首先把H5项目文件夹拷贝到Xcode项目下在Xcode里面,显示是绿色的文件夹,而不是黄色的文件夹。
天下只此一家
·
2020-08-18 02:03
iOS
本地H5文件
css
js
WKWebView
与JS交互
WKWebView
是苹果在iOS8推出的,用来替换UIWebView,相比UIWebView,
WKWebView
速度更快,占用内存更少。
天下只此一家
·
2020-08-18 02:03
iOS
Sync JavaScript in
WKWebView
CreatesyncversionUIWebViewjavascriptmethodissynctype.Ontheotherhand,WKWebViewevaluateJavaScript:completionHandler:isasynctype.Actually,wecangettheresultfromcallbackmethod.But,sometimesneedsynctype,wai
iJecky
·
2020-08-18 00:52
iOS开发技术系列专栏
iOS
WKWebView
点击超链接跳转至Safari
-(void)webView:(
WKWebView
*)webViewdecidePolicyForNavigationAction:(WKNavigationAction*)navigationActiondecisionHandler
tian-heng
·
2020-08-17 23:22
iOS 如何让
WKWebView
侧滑返回时html逐级返回,而不是直接返回到上级控制器?
iOS使用
WKWebView
来加载html页面时,如果html页面只有一级的话,那么侧滑返回没什么问题,但如果html是多级的话,那么侧滑返回时有时就会出现直接返回到上级控制器,而不是返回上一级html
huxinguang002
·
2020-08-17 22:32
ios
iOS
WKWebView
与JS交互
假设JS的交互代码是//content为AndroidWebView需要获取到的数据,多个用,隔开,如果不需要传值{}也要加,window.webkit.messageHandlers.openCop.postMessage只有openCop是可以修改的名称其他是固定写法window.webkit.messageHandlers.openCop.postMessage({content});那么i
XLawsZero
·
2020-08-17 20:36
iOS
HTML
iOS
UIWebView
iOS用
WKWebView
与JS交互获取系统图片及
WKWebView
的Alert,Confirm,TextInput的监听代理方法使用,屏蔽WebView的可选菜单
WKWebVIew
的内存线程管理好,所以选择使用
WKWebVIew
(使用
WKWebView
的缺点在于,这个控件加载的H5页面不支持ajax请求,所以需要自己把网络请求在OC上实现)。
启程Boy
·
2020-08-17 19:39
iOS
WKWebView
OC与JS交互详解
IOS开发(7)
WKWebView
加载本地HTML、CSS、JS文件JS(解决html内访问其他资源路径问题)
UIWebVIew和
WKWebView
都是ios提供的web控件。但是后者比前者性能更好,占用内存更少。
ruyulin
·
2020-08-17 09:43
IOS
iOS开发
WKWebView
如何清除缓存2018-08-16
概述iOS7.0只有UIWebView,而iOS8.0是有
WKWebView
,但8.0的
WKWebView
没有删除缓存方法。iOS9.0之后就开始支持啦。
Leecsdn77
·
2020-08-16 11:58
IOS 解决
WKWebView
加载本地html资源文件异常处理
wkwebView
加载本地资源时,有时候无法加载全css等资源文件。导致无线显示。
ActiveC
·
2020-08-15 20:42
IOS
iOS9以下版本使用
WKWebView
加载本地HTML文件不显示,处理时容易忽略的问题
昨天修改bug的时候,遇到一个关于
WKWebView
加载本地HTML文件iOS9以下版本手机不显示的问题,然后我三下五除二的将本地HTML文件,以及js,css,image等copy到了tmp目录中,然后等运行结果
是大喵啊~
·
2020-08-15 20:08
iOS
WKWebView
内容显示不全问题
最近项目在嵌套h5网页,使用苹果
WKWebView
来展示,在5s上展示是可以的,但是在6或者7上会显示不全。全是感觉
WKWebView
跑到屏幕外边去了。
like学
·
2020-08-15 19:10
iOS
开发
iOS
WKWebView
加载本地文件之权威解说
在实际的iOS开发中,我们有很多的地方需要通过
WKWebView
加载本地的文件。但是由于
WKWebview
存在着一些跨域的问题。UIWebView直接加载的方法不能正常使用了。
JackLee18
·
2020-08-15 18:19
Object-C
IOS
WKWebview
与JavaScript 交互(二)监听远程网页点击事件
引言监听网页的按钮的点击事件,并且网页不是我们招呼一声对方就能改的。那么继续。正文1.WKUserScript先介绍WebKit框架一个类WKUserScript:核心方法,传入JS代码字符串,返回给我们一个WKUserScript对象。/*!@abstractReturnsaninitializeduserscriptthatcanbeaddedtoa@linkWKUserContentCont
garvinbao
·
2020-08-15 17:29
iOS
Objective-C
JavaScript
WKWebview
调用js的方法以及遇到的坑
众所周知
wkwebview
调用js的方法,要调用如下代码-(void)evaluateJavaScript:(NSString*)javaScriptStringcompletionHandler:(void
磊怀
·
2020-08-15 17:23
IT
iOS
WKWebview
捕获点击事件
1.js注入:letuserContent=WKUserContentController()userContent.add(self,name:"quitCourse")letjsContent="functionquit(){window.webkit.messageHandlers.quitCourse.postMessage(null);}(function(){varbtn=docume
每天都有进步
·
2020-08-15 16:59
IOS
webview和H5交互
UIWebView及WKWebViewWKWebView是14年随iOS8推出的,很好的解决了UIWebView加载速度慢,内存占用大的问题WebViewJavaScriptBridge是一款轻量级的框架,使用它结合
wkwebview
weixin_34279184
·
2020-08-15 16:41
iOS中js调用oc获取返回值(
WKWebView
)
前言最近公司的APP需要进行hybrid模式的开发,即native和h5联合开发。此时前端工程师提到了一个需求,由前端调用native进行操作以及获取返回值。这样可以保证native只有一份代码,h5不用指定方法和native进行确认。为了实现这个需求,从网上的给出的解决办法来看,一种是使用原生的类和库方法,另外一种是使用第三方库。本文主要介绍使用原生类库进行操作。实现效果(demo)demo实现
JessicaLilyAn
·
2020-08-15 14:18
IOS
UIWebView和
WKWebView
的使用及js交互
UIWebView和
WKWebView
的使用及js交互web页面和app直接的交互是很常见的东西,之前尝试过flex和js的相互调用以及android和js的相互调用,却只有ios没试过,据说比较复杂。
dabin12345
·
2020-08-15 13:29
WKWebView
返回某个历史页面
WKWebView
有时候,在h5页面进行跳转的时候,需要退出到某个加载历史的web页面,此时则需要使用
WKWebView
里面新增的API。
high_flying_boy
·
2020-08-15 13:57
iOS---经典教程
OC与JS的交互(iOS与H5混编)
iOS中加载html网页,可以使用UIWebView或
WKWebView
.本篇博客将介绍两种控件使用过程中如何实现OC与JS的交互。
SandyLoo
·
2020-08-15 13:41
IOS开发知识
WKWebView
与H5交互的两种方式
交互方式一:原生交互(以
WKWebView
为栗子)1.原生调用H5方法[wkWebViewevaluateJavaScript:@"js方法名"completionHandler:^(id_Nullableresponse
乐橙Web
·
2020-08-15 13:50
混合开发
关于解决
WKWebView
不能显示网页PDF文件的实战
测试提了这样的一个bug,就结合项目开始搜索相关资料终于找到了解决方案:直接上代码:添加
WKWebView
的代理方法-(void)webView:(
WKWebView
*)webViewdecidePolicyForNavigationResponse
FreeTourW
·
2020-08-15 13:37
iOS实战
WKWebview
使用攻略
本文字数:3873字预计阅读时间:10分钟现在我们的app都需要使用
WKWebview
来加载h5页面了,但是使用过程中有些细节需要注意,通过本篇文章可以让大家更加完善的了解
WKWebview
的使用。
Mo_mo???
·
2020-08-14 16:03
在线教育平台开发中,作业功能中的图片上传是如何实现的
下面小编就以iOS版本的在线教育平台开发为例,来说明下,如何使用
WKWebView
来实现图片排列。一、先创建一个
wkwebview
-(
WKWebView
*)wkWebV{if(!
万岳教育
·
2020-08-14 14:55
在线教育平台开发
WKWebview
之Cookie小结
首先来看一下NSHTTPCookieStorage这个类:/*!@classNSHTTPCookieStorage@discussionNSHTTPCookieStorageimplementsasingletonobject(sharedinstance)whichmanagesthesharedcookiestore.Ithasmethodstoallowclientstosetandremo
Coder.L
·
2020-08-14 14:12
iOS
Swift
WKWebView
Cookies
JS使用的API方法变得简单支持Swift4支持与原生代码共享Cookies关于Cookies共享方法1:将isNeedShareCookies属性至为true此种方式在iOS11.0以后的系统中使用
WKWebView
GTMYang
·
2020-08-13 15:31
ios
Swift
解决页面退出 WebView 继续播放视频音乐的问题
前言在iOS的开发中,使用webview/
wkwebview
加载H5页面,已经是司空见惯的行为了。本篇就源于在开发中解决页面跳转后webview中视屏没有停止播放的问题。
Micah_A
·
2020-08-13 15:49
iOS
上一页
19
20
21
22
23
24
25
26
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他